Fire sprinklers save lives

Iam writing this letter in response to the fire that occurred on Jan. 8 at 3130 N. Lake Shore Drive. I was under the impression that the City of Chicago had passed a ruling that ordered building owners to equip their buildings with some sort of life safety system. I was shocked to hear that this ruling has not been enforced and the result is the loss of human life. From what I have read on this subject, building owners are citing the cost of equipping a building with fire sprinklers as the problem. I truly believe that the cost of supplying fire sprinklers would be dramatically less than the cost of just one lawsuit linked to a death in a fire. Please begin enforcing these regulations and stop the senseless loss of money and human life.
